Lifeguarding is more than just sitting on a beach; it's about proactively ensuring the safety of others. It requires physical fitness, strong aquatic abilities, and quick decision-making. With proper training, you'll learn essential skills for preventing accidents, responding to emergencies, and providing first aid.
- Let's start by a look at the key steps involved in becoming a certified lifeguard:
- Investigate reputable lifeguarding training courses in your area.
- Meet the required age and other criteria set by the training provider.
- Successfully complete a swimming assessment to demonstrate your proficiency.
- Participate comprehensive lifeguard training, which includes both theoretical and practical components.
- Earn your certification from a recognized agency.
